Frederique van der Wal Instagram - All of these pictures are of me, but with very different looks applied. 

The transformations are achieved through various layers, such as makeup, hairstyling, great clothes, retouching, or filters and ofcourse the photographers.

I’ve always admired the talent of hair and makeup artists, as well as stylists, designers and photographers. It’s truly remarkable what the right team can accomplish.

This reminds me of a program I hosted and produced 15 years ago called Covershot for the A&E network. We would select everyday women who had gone through difficult times and give them a complete transformation with the help of a fantastic team of makeup artists, hairstylists, stylists, and a photographer. The big reveal would be a billboard in Times Square, New York.

It was incredible to witness the transformation and the positive impact it had on these women. It gave them a tremendous boost of confidence.

However, I believe that experiencing such a transformation firsthand is even more empowering. That being said, it’s important to remember that when we scroll through social media, online platforms, or even magazines (showing my age here), the pictures we see may be taken by professionals, manipulated by apps, or even generated by AI. They may not accurately represent the people.

In a world filled with carefully curated images and unrealistic standards, it’s easy to get caught up in the comparison game. But I think that beauty is not solely defined by flawless skin, impeccable makeup, or the perfect outfit. 
It’s about embracing our unique features, quirks, and imperfections that make us who we are.

Frederique van der Wal Instagram - My dad used to call me a water rat, affectionately ofcourse ;))

From a very young age, I developed a passion for swimming and it became a lifelong pursuit of discovering and exploring new waters and oceans. 
In the United States, I became a certified diver and had the opportunity to do the first underwater reporting for E! And Access Hollywood, years ago.

Throughout the years, I have been fortunate to contribute to several programs organized by Celebration of the Sea. 
One particular program that remains etched in my memory involved terminally ill children swimming with dolphins. Witnessing the profound impact it had on these kids was truly remarkable.

This past week I had the privilege of being present once again to witness the incredible work that Celebration of the Sea continues to do. From their Ocean Heroes education programs to their cleanup initiatives, they consistently inspire and engage communities to bring about positive change. It is truly inspiring to see their dedication and the difference they are making.

Frederique van der Wal Instagram - I just learned of the passing of a great photographer Hans Feurer. 

It made me reflect on the passage of time.

I find myself trying to recall those days of shooting with him on distant beaches in the late eighties and early nineties. 
The memories of traveling to those incredible beaches and locations flood my mind. I believe this particular shoot was in Cabo San Lucas or perhaps a Caribbean island. Back then, the shoots were extravagant, and we would spend a week in a stunning resort, capturing an eight-page editorial. Those days are long gone, the industry changed drastically. 

And that innocent-looking girl too. ;)

Sometimes, I find myself in awe of all the travel and how fortunate I was. Lucky to have had those incredible experiences and even luckier to have remained grounded and strong, preserving my sanity. My career has taken me in countless directions, expanding and evolving along the way.

While I wouldn’t want to go back to those days, I like where I am now. My mind and soul are in a good place, although my body could use a reboot here and there ;))

Frederique van der Wal Instagram - From the wonderful crazy life in the New York City jungle I was ready to change it up and dive into the ocean. 

I had been invited to witness firsthand the impact of rising ocean water temperatures on coral reefs. Joining the amazing organization I.CARE with Mike and Patxi, I was able to see their work on coral restoration and gain a deeper understanding of the effects of climate change on our underwater ecosystems. It becomes even more clear to me that everything is connected.

Every day, we witness the effects of climate change on our surroundings - floods, fires, and the loss of species and nature. But to see what is happening beneath the surface, we sometimes seem to forget and it’s heart-wrenching. 
However, with the efforts of organizations like I.CARE and Dr. Cindy Lewis director of Florida Institute of Oceanography’s Keys Marine Lab, there is hope.

Our first dive was disheartening, as much of the coral that had been planted had bleached. However, we were pleasantly surprised during our second dive. The energy was immediately better, and we witnessed life, action, vibrant colors, and an abundance of fish. The sponges that had been planted there were alive and had grown. Nature is resilient and finds ways to adapt and resist. On the other hand, we humans need to make changes in our behavior.

It feels good to be on the front lines and witness firsthand the efforts of so many people. 

I am trying to make a difference,
 by using my water bottle instead of buying plastic bottles. 
To use no plastic around the house If everyone stops or drastically reduces their consumption of plastic bottles, the impact would be enormous.
I am also taking the time to understand the ingredients in the products I use. I have learned about the harmful effects of microbeads, which are tiny plastic particles found in cleaning products, cosmetics, and skincare. By being more conscious of what I buy, I can make choices that are better for the environment and for myself.

I have adopted a mindset of mindful consumption. Instead of buying unnecessary things, I am focusing on reducing my overall consumption. By doing so, I hope to contribute to a more sustainable future.
